Adoption of Lightweight Materials as a Result of Strict Emission Regulations

The most commonly used materials for car parts and component applications are Polypropylene (PP),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C), Acrylonitrile Butadiene Styrene (ABS), and Polyurethane (PU). Based on fuel-efficiency regulations and performance requirements, an average automobile typically contains 5.8 to 10% plastics, with consumption in vehicular equipment accounting for more than 110–120 kg. Due to rising customer demand for high-performance, lightweight, and fuel-efficient automobiles, this percentage is anticipated to rise in the coming years, boosting the requirement for automotive plastics. Additionally, reduction in the weight offers a cost-effective way to lower fuel usage and gre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ions, conserving non-renewable crude oil sources. For instance, a vehicle's fuel efficiency would increase by 5 to 7% for every 10% reduction in weight.

In addition to being lightweight, polymeric materials also have a broad range of adjustability in terms of their visual appeal, tactile feel, acoustic behaviour, and odour. Automotive plastics are regarded as a true alternative for producing seat coverings, steering wheels, seat bases, load floors, headliners, rear package shelves, and fascia systems. Increased Demand for Propylene is Providing Traction to Automotive Plastics Market

In 2022, the automotive plastics market was dominated by the polypropylene category, which had a revenue share of more than one-third. The increased product demand from end-use sectors such packaging, electrical and electronics, construction, consumer goods, and automotive is crucial for this expansion. Due to its physical and chemical properties, polypropylene is used in both rigid and flexible packaging. In addition, it has outstanding electrical and chemical resistance at extremely high temperatures. Because PP is relatively lightweight compared to other polymers, used in the automobile industry to lighten the total weight of cars, which helps drastically cut on fuel use as well as carbon dioxide emissions. In 2022, polyvinyl chloride grew to become the second-largest product category. Underbody coatings, sealants, floor modules, wire harnesses, passenger compartment components, and external components are just a few of its many automotive applications.

Impact of COVID-19 on the Global Passenger Car Plastics Market

Owing COVID-19 pandemic, the passenger car industry had a negative effect as the sales were plummeted, manufacturing facilities were shut down, there was a shortage of car components, and working capital fell. It caused the supply chain to be disrupted and production to be suspended, which decreased retail sales. Additionally, a lot of people's purchasing choices were influenced by their uncertainty about their employment and the long-term economic and health repercussions of the virus on their life. According to the OICA, global passenger automobile sales fell by -15.8% in 2020, from 63.7 million units in 2019 to 53.6 million units. The automotive plastics industry for passenger vehicles, which depends on the sale of passenger automobiles, is predicted to be significantly impacted by this outbreak. Continuous Automotive Industry Growth Establishes a Strong Basis for Players Operating in Asia Pacific Region

In 2021, Asia Pacific led the market and accounted for over 2/5 of total revenue. Facilities are likely to move from established nations to growing economies in Asia Pacific, notably in China, India, Thailand, Vietnam, and Indonesia. A new age of automobiles is anticipated, which will have a favourable impact on the market for automotive plastics. This will be brought about by expanding the manufacturing base and rising investments in cutting-edge technology for vehicle production. European and APAC consumers pay particular attention to fuel economy. This has also increased demand for sustainable plastics. For instance, the Indian Oil Corporation (IOC) and two other public sector oil corporations announced plans to install 22,000 electric car charging stations over the next three to five years in November 2021. In 2021, Europe ranked as the second-biggest market for automotive plastics. High-performance plastics are used by automakers in Europe because they are energy-efficient and contribute to the lightening of the car. Automakers in European nations have been compelled to switch from diesel engines to electric motors due to the region's strict pollution regulations. Over the period of the forecast, this is also anticipated to boost product demand.
